What happens when you list with Campbells

If you are ready to move forward, here is exactly what happens when you instruct us, from the first conversation through to the day you hand over the keys.

If you are ready to move forward, here is exactly what happens when you instruct us, from the first conversation through to the day you hand over the keys.

You get a named associate

Someone who knows your area properly, and who stays involved from the first conversation through to completion, not just at the start. You will always know who to call, and they will already know your situation without needing it explained again from scratch.

We agree the right approach together

Traditional Sale, Soft Launch or Express Sale, whichever suits your circumstances, along with a realistic timeline and pricing strategy based on real evidence rather than a figure designed simply to win your instruction.

We prepare it properly

Photography, floorplans and paperwork are arranged before your property goes live, so it makes the right impression from day one rather than needing to be corrected once it is already public.

We market it properly, and qualify interest carefully

Your property is shown first to our registered buyers, then across the major portals, and we check that buyers are genuinely able to proceed before bringing you an offer. Over the last 12 months, that combination has meant 86% of our clients complete on their sale, against a regional average of 57%, and we have sold, subject to contract, 92% of the properties we list, against a regional average of 64%.

It also means fewer properties sitting unsold or needing a price cut along the way: we have withdrawn only 13% of our properties from the market, against a regional average of 43%, and reduced the asking price on only 18%, against a regional average of 41%.

On average, we achieve within 1.33% of the original marketing price, against a regional average of around 3%, worth roughly £6,000 more on the average sale. That is what sits behind our approach: to sell your property for the most money, in the quickest amount of time, with the least amount of inconvenience.

We stay involved right through to completion

From qualifying buyer interest to progressing the sale after an offer is accepted, you will always know who to speak to and what is happening, right through to the day you hand over the keys.
